Spock Posted December 4, 2015 Posted December 4, 2015 That should be possible. You just need to find one that tweaked with ELFX and CoT in mind, or the colors will look strange. As far as I know Skylight is a little easier on performance.
Aiyen Posted December 4, 2015 Posted December 4, 2015 If you like the visuals then the best thing to do first would be to lower the various quality parameters. Most can be lowered further without massive detrimental effects. The ENB guide here on the site should be comprehensive enough to help you with that by now. Otherwise just check out what I have put in skylight and try that out. Last I checked most of the compute intensive stuff was similar in the files used.
Darth_mathias Posted December 4, 2015 Posted December 4, 2015 (edited) i personally use the Vivid performance version of Vividian ENB with my SRLE I turn off DOF (cos i don't like it) and I turn off amibant occlusion and cloud shadows and i gain 10 sometimes 15 frames per second.
